Former Chechen president Yandarbiyev killed in car explosion

FORMER Chechen president Zelimkhan Yandarbiyev, who has been linked to al-Qaida and was accused by Russia of maintaining international terrorist ties, was killed yesterday after his car exploded in the Qatari capital Doha.

An official at the Qatari interior ministry said the explosion killed Mr Yandarbiyev and injured his 13-year-old son.

A doctor at Hamad General Hospital said Mr Yandarbiyev died from his injuries on his way to the hospital. His son was in a critical condition.
